Inside MPAC's November and December Lineup

originally published: 11/04/2020


(MORRISTOWN, NJ) -- Mayo Performing Arts Center (MPAC) will stage a series of limited capacity concerts for up to 150 people throughout November and December. From local artists such as James Gedeon and Anthony Krizan to top tribute bands performing the music of Fleetwood Mac, the Grateful Dead and Led Zeppelin, there are opportunities to enjoy a wide range of music. 

In addition to in-person concerts, many of these events will be featured on MPAC's exclusive livestream so you can enjoy them from home. MPAC brings the concert experience straight into your home with exclusive livestreaming of many of its fall events. MPAC Livestreams cost $20 per household and are only available simultaneously with the live concert on the stage. The MPAC Livestream provides high quality audio and video HD broadcast quality concerts directly from the MPAC stage.

"With our livestream, MPAC is offering something that is unique to performing arts centers in New Jersey," said Allison Larena, President and CEO, MPAC. "Now you can be part of the audience, experiencing the same excitement going on in our theatre, right from your living room, as it's happening live."

Anthony Krizan and Friends - Friday, November 13, 2020 at 8:00pm. Guitarist Anthony Krizan calls his music "blues infused rock & roll with soulful swampy under tones." One of the premier songwriters and producers in the New York area, Krizan has penned music as lead guitarist of the popular jam band The Spin Doctors as well as for artists including Lenny Kravitz ("Stand By My Woman"), John Waite and Gretchen Wilson.

$35-$50. Livestream available for $20.

Trivia Night - Thursday, November 19 at 7:00pm. Form your team and test your knowledge in all things trivia! $40 per team (max four players per team). Limited space available.

Tusk - Saturday, November 21 at 6:00pm and 8:30pm. Tusk is the top Fleetwood Mac tribute band it the world. Using no fancy gimmicks, Tusk performs the music of Fleetwood Mac to perfection with note by note renditions of your favorite hits such as "Don't Stop," "Go Your Own Way," "Dreams" and "The Chain."

$39-$59. Livestream available for $20 for 8:30pm.

Manhattan Comedy Night - Friday, November 27, 2020 at 6:00pm and 8:30pm. Get some comic relief with our popular stand-up series showcasing the rising stars of comedy. Mature content, language. Adults only. $30

An Evening with James Gedeon & Friends featuring Jim Nuzzo, Bruce Alcott and Lou Giola - Saturday, November 28 at 7:30pm. Singer-songwriter James Gedeon (former Morristown Onstage champion), keyboardist Jim Nuzzo (Distinguished Company, Network), bassist Bruce Alcott (Bernie Williams Band, Paul Simon) and drummer Lou Gioia (Bernie Williams Band) draw from a vast pop music catalog including James Taylor, Sting, Billy Joel and The Doobies Brothers as well as original songs in an evening of music and stories. $29-$49. Livestream: $20

Kashmir - The Live Led Zeppelin Show - Saturday, December 5 at 6:00pm and 8:30pm. Kashmir recreates the sounds, the authenticity, and the experience of Led Zeppelin on tour, capturing the raw energy that the world's greatest rock band brought to concert halls around the world. $39-$59. Livestream available for $20 for 8:30pm.

The Sicilian Tenors: Christmas Amore! - Sunday, December 6 at 3:00pm and 7:00pm. The Sicilian Tenors - Aaron Caruso, Elio Scaccio and Sam Vitale -- bring together three marvelous tenor voices backed by a pianist, each performing their favorite holiday music and other popular songs that audiences of all ages will love. $49-$59. Livestream available for $20 for 7:00pm. 

Frontiers - The Ultimate Journey Tribute Band: A Very Special Holiday Show - Saturday, December 12 at 6:00pm and 8:30pm.  Don't stop believin' in the holiday spirit! Frontiers takes you back to the '80's era, performing Journey's timeless chart topping hits such as "Open Arms," "Separate Ways (Worlds Apart)," "Send Her My Love," "Faithfully," "Don't Stop Believin'," "Who's Crying Now" and more as well as some of your favorite holiday tunes! "Hands down, Frontiers is my favorite Journey tribute to Journey" - Steve Perry. $39-$49. Livestream available for $20 for 8:30pm.

​​​​​​​

Dead On Live - Celebrating 50 years of American Beauty - Saturday, December 19 at 7:00pm. Dead on Live performs the classic album American Beauty in its entirety, along with other Grateful Dead favorites in a freer, looser more interpretive style. Rather than having the band play the songs, they're letting the songs play the band! $39-$59.

Mayo Performing Arts Center (MPAC) is located at 100 South Street in Morristown, New Jersey. MPAC, a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ization, presents a wide range of programs that entertain, enrich, and educate the diverse population of the region and enhance the economic vitality of Northern New Jersey. The 2020-2021 season is made possible, in part, by a grant the New Jersey State Council on the Arts/Department of State, a Partner Agency of the National Endowment for the Arts, as well as support received from the F.M. Kirby Foundation and numerous corporations, foundations and individuals. Mayo Performing Arts Center was named 2016 Outstanding Historic Theatre by the League of Historic American Theatres, and is ranked in the top 50 mid-sized performing arts centers by Pollstar Magazine.
